Managed to fit in a couple of rides either side of the enjoyable French Foray. On the morning before departure had a nice pedal with Tim over to Salway Ash, nice blue skies but cool wind, Tim was going well, he manged to get a few bike lengths on me on the challenging climbs. The hard bits were climbing up from the Marshwood Vale up to Marshwood and the climb up past the the Fern Hill Hotel (out of Charmouth towards Lyme Regis). Following the relaxing French Foray (no sea sickness - hurrah!) I rode home from the Monkey Jump end of Dorchester, route took me past the Hardy Monument down to Burton Bradstock, Bridport, Eype, North Chideock, Morecombelake, Charmouth and Lyme Regis. It would have been a great ride but there was a corking chilly headwind all the way home. I saw load of other cyclists going the other direction who looked much happier than me ! I tagged along with 3 Sid Valley chaps for one of their race training rides on Tuesday evening. Pretty brisk apart from stopping to fix a flat, route the same as last week, out to Honiton Golf Club then over to Fairmile and Ottery. Young Toby was the star of the final climb out of Tipton and managed to drop the rest of us oldies. Before the ride I was asking him if hed done much riding recently which he replied he had but on a horse ! Apparently he prefers the bike to the horse given the choice.
